coggle \cog"gle\, n. see cog small boat.
a small fishing boat. --ham. nav. encyc.
1913 webster

coggle \cog"gle\, n. cf. cobble a cobblestone.
a cobblestone. prov. eng. --halliwell.
1913 webster

coggle
v 1: walk unsteadily; "small children toddle" syn: toddle, totter,
dodder, paddle, waddle
2: move unsteadily; "his knees wobbled"; "the old cart wobbled
down the street" syn: wobble
